Implementation of 5:10:15:20 Minute Model With Improvement in First-Case On-Time Starts.

Shruti Parikh, Thomas Corrado, Joseph Gnolfo

    Journal for Healthcare Quality : Official Publication of the National Association for Healthcare Quality
    |January 26, 2026
    PubMed
    Summary
    This summary is machine-generated.

    Implementing explicit deadlines and feedback significantly improved first-case on-time starts (FCOTS) in the operating room (OR). This initiative enhanced OR efficiency, reducing delays and associated hospital costs.

    Area of Science:

    • Healthcare Management
    • Surgical Operations
    • Quality Improvement

    Background:

    • The operating room (OR) is a complex, dynamic setting where effective communication among surgical, anesthesia, and clinical teams is crucial.
    • First-case on-time starts (FCOTS) serve as a key performance indicator for OR efficiency.
    • OR delays are frequently caused by multiple factors and can lead to increased healthcare expenditures.

    Purpose of the Study:

    • To assess the impact of implementing explicit task deadlines and providing feedback to clinicians on improving FCOTS.
    • To evaluate the effectiveness of a multicomponent quality improvement initiative aimed at enhancing OR efficiency.

    Main Methods:

    • A pre- and post-implementation study was conducted at a tertiary care, Level 1 trauma institution.
    • The intervention included establishing explicit deadlines for perioperative tasks, delivering feedback to surgeons with late starts, and utilizing OR tracking boards.
    • Patients undergoing elective or urgent surgery with an American Society of Anesthesiologists (ASA) classification score of 4 or less were included.

    Main Results:

    • A total of 14,609 patients were analyzed (6,635 preimplementation, 7,974 postimplementation), with balanced demographic and clinical characteristics between groups.
    • First-case on-time starts (FCOTS) significantly increased from 39.0% preimplementation to 74.0% postimplementation (p < .0001).
    • With a 5-minute grace period, the monthly average FCOTS improved from 54.8% to 83.2% (p < .0001).

    Conclusions:

    • The integration of a central OR tracking board, clinician feedback mechanisms, and specific time-based goals (5:10:15:20 minutes) led to a substantial improvement in FCOTS.
    • This quality improvement project demonstrates a successful strategy for enhancing operating room efficiency and reducing delays.
